Welcome to the BE ENCOURAGED! Podcast! I am your host, Jackie Brindle and you are listening to episode 107. Thank you for joining me! There was a long break since the last episode, so I appreciate your patience, as you graciously awaited the return of a NEW episode! A reminder—- each new episode will air every other Monday — so mark your calendars and set the date to listen in to a message that will be sure to encourage you in your daily life and your faith. Today, this is a special episode because I sat down with Angela U. Carter, who is a mother, grandmother, pastor, and community advocate against domestic violence and abuse, and who also is a domestic abuse survivor herself. In addition, she is the author of a book titled: “Letters to Ma Mama: All the Things I Never Said”. —- available now on Amazon or on the link below. As you listen today, take notes! Angela infuses our conversation with her own life experiences and she reveals insight on how to be aware of the red flags one should notice in a new relationship and what red flags to recognize if you are in an abnormal relationship vs. a normal relationship. She speaks truth with love today — knowing that this might be a difficult subject for some, as they might be a survivor themselves, experiencing domestic violence, and you can always circle back to this even if you are not ready to listen to this one yet. Personally, now that I know more, I am compelled to lead with compassion to help domestic violence and abuse centers and more overtly to value the lives of others. We never know what someone is walking through or has walked through so I hope this lets you know today that YOU ARE NOT ALONE!
